Saudi moves to control the used car market and reduce prices
While the Saudi Zakat, Tax and Customs Authority decided to apply the value-added tax calculation to supplies of used cars according to the profit margin at the beginning of next July, Asharq Al-Awsat learned that the new steps came in response to the demands of the Federation of Saudi Chambers, representing the business sector in the country, in A step to regulate and control the local market, as well as reduce the prices of used vehicles.
According to the information, the Federation of Saudi Chambers recently held several meetings with the authority for the purpose of implementing Article 48 of the executive regulations of the value-added tax system, which defines the mechanisms for the supply of used goods, the most prominent of which is that the taxable person may apply to calculate the tax due. For the supply of qualified used goods by using the profit margin method in accordance with the conditions set forth in this Article.

Specialists told Asharq Al-Awsat that the new decision issued by the Zakat, Tax and Customs Authority is in line with the previous package of measures from the Ministry of Commerce aimed at controlling the car market in Saudi Arabia.
Faisal Abu Shusheh, head of the National Committee for Car Dealers in the Federation of Saudi Chambers, told Asharq Al-Awsat that the decision will balance prices by calculating value-added tax on profit margins, and therefore the addition will be symbolic and contribute to lowering prices.
Faisal Abu Shusheh explained that, in the past year, the Ministry of Commerce took 10 measures based on its role and responsibilities aimed at protecting the consumer from improper practices and reviewing the ways of doing business in the country, indicating at the same time that the efforts made by the government contribute to providing supply to consumers. Abu Shusheh added that the previous regime had a significant impact on the used car market by raising the value of the commodity by about 15 percent, and repeatedly calculating the tax more than once on the consumer, in addition to not controlling and following up the market from manipulating the sale of vehicles in the name of the individual and not in the name of the exhibition. .
The head of the National Committee for Car Dealers continued that the new decision by the Zakat, Tax and Customs Authority helps to comply with the regular payment of value-added tax on profit margins, and to prevent fraud in used car sales.

Recently, the Saudi Ministry of Commerce has taken accelerated moves to protect the local car market from improper practices, after it witnessed a rise in prices and a crisis in delivering vehicles to customers, to take 10 measures, the most important of which are: communicating with manufacturers to increase the share allocated to the Kingdom of the most demanded vehicles, as well as carrying out Dealers give individual consumers priority in providing cars and reduce the share of distributors and showrooms.
Among the measures taken are also the monitoring of distributors and showrooms to ensure that there are no violating practices that are harmful to the consumer, the governance of reservation lists at car dealerships and the promotion of transparency, in addition to providing the ministry with a weekly report on the prices of vehicles with high demand, their quantities, the date of their arrival, and the number of reservation requests.
The Ministry of Commerce obligated car dealerships to publish prices, policies, instructions and special procedures on their websites, and to stop leasing companies from selling new vehicles, taking advantage of the high prices, and ensuring that they are only purchased for the purpose of leasing.
